Hi everybody, this is my first post here and also my first time using PlayOnLinux or even Wine besides some intents a few years ago, so my knowledge about this topic is a bit (more than a bit) low and also maybe my english doesn't help I will do my best to explain.
So, I always tryed to use Linux and stay on it but I always tend to play the most annoying games to run on Linux, today with PlayOnLinux, Lutris and Steam I know that the game is coming close to an end but this old games on private servers will always be an issue I guess. I just want Path of Exile and Lineage 2 to go full Linux today and I know that Path of Exile apparently works like a charm but didn't test it, today I need Lineage 2.
EDIT/3/
Information about my setting:
Distro: Pop! Os 20.04 | nvidia version
Full PC Specs: Ryzen 7 3700X | 32 Gb RAM 3200 Mhz (16x2) | ASUS ROG RTX 2060 | Gigabyte X570 AORUS ELITE | NVME Samsung EVO 970 Pro+
Desktop: KDE Plasma
So basically what have I done?.
I installed the game client with the official installer for the version needed in this private server, then I downloaded a "Pre-installed all parched" version of the game, because the game need to be patched for this particular server like any other private server, so the idea was to install the game, erase all files in
$HOME/.PlayOnLinux/wineprefix/l2h5/drive_c/Program Files/NCsoft/Lineage II/
And then put the preinstalled all patched version, I also tryed just patching what it was needed to be patched but same result.
Point of this game and everything is that when I ran the ../Lineage II/System/L2.exe first it start the "Hacking prevention software" the StrixPlatform, this apparently works because I see the splash and the progress bar in the bottom right but after that nothing happens, well PlayOnLinux says it crashed but testing it with Lutris or just Wine nothing happens, so I ran it in debug and found this errors:
[07/28/20 13:29:18] - Running wine-5.13 l2.exe (Working directory : /home/hexploder/.PlayOnLinux/wineprefix/l2h5/drive_c/Program Files/NCsoft/Lineage II/System)
006c:err:ntoskrnl:ZwLoadDriver failed to create driver L"\\Registry\\Machine\\System\\CurrentControlSet\\Services\\wineusb": c0000142
003c:fixme:service:scmdatabase_autostart_services Auto-start service L"wineusb" failed to start: 1114
0024:err:module:LdrInitializeThunk "engine.dll" failed to initialize, aborting
0024:err:module:LdrInitializeThunk Initializing dlls for L"C:\\Program Files\\NCsoft\\Lineage II\\System\\l2.exe" failed, status c0000005
I searched for an answer but couldn't really find anything specific and my knowledge about this is not enough to figure it out by myself.
BTW, when installed this I followed other people that get the game working (not for this particular server) and they say to install the following which I did:
- corefonts
- dotnet20
- msxml4
- vcrun2008
- Tahoma
And I did this all on a 32 bits prefix, cause the game is a 32 bit game.
Any help help would be much appreciated.
Regards
EDIT/1/
Tryed with wine 2.14 which was recomended, when I did that "Wine Gecko" tryed to installed but after the progress bar completed nothing happens and freezes the window so I have to manually close it because it did not respond. Anyway, after that I tryed again but a similar error arises again.
[07/28/20 14:34:19] - Running wine-2.14 l2.exe (Working directory : /home/hexploder/.PlayOnLinux/wineprefix/l2h5/drive_c/Program Files/NCsoft/Lineage II/System)
err:module:load_builtin_dll failed to load .so lib for builtin L"winebus.sys": libudev.so.0: cannot open shared object file: No such file or directory
err:winedevice:async_create_driver failed to create driver L"winebus": c0000142
err:module:attach_process_dlls "engine.dll" failed to initialize, aborting
err:module:LdrInitializeThunk Main exe initialization for L"C:\\Program Files\\NCsoft\\Lineage II\\System\\l2.exe" failed, status c0000005
EDIT/2/
Despite I installed dotnet20 with POL in the wine configuration libraries tab like the others.
https://ibb.co/LrJhBDS
Regards
Edited by Hexploder